Training a Bengal as a Virgo

Your Virgo precision makes you adept at breaking down training into small, manageable steps, which works brilliantly for a Bengal's intelligent but often impetuous nature. Repetitive, consistent command delivery will stick with them, but expect them to test boundaries often. Avoid any harsh methods; a Bengal will shut down or become more rebellious, completely frustrating your desire for orderly progress. Positive reinforcement with high-value treats and praise for their mental effort will yield the best results.

Yes, many Bengals are fascinated by water, a trait from their wild ancestors! Instead of fighting it, channel it. Get a pet water fountain for them to play with, or even set up a shallow basin with some floating toys. This satisfies their natural inclination without turning your meticulously cleaned bathroom into a splash zone. Just make sure the water source is clean and safe.

Bengals are indeed known for their extensive vocal repertoire, far beyond a simple meow. Your Virgo analytical skills will shine here! Pay close attention to the context of each sound: a short chirp often signals curiosity or a greeting, while a deeper growl might express displeasure or territoriality. Over time, you'll start to meticulously map their individual 'language,' allowing you to respond appropriately and maintain harmony in your home.
